Madam Speaker, the member is always interesting to listen to; I like his style. The member mentioned the 4.4% target, and I know in my riding of Port Moody—Coquitlam there is a strong francophone community, but a lot of the older generation are moving away and moving out. The young people, the kids, are the ones who want to learn French, and their parents want them to learn French. We had difficulty finding a school like École des Pionniers. We actually had to move outside of the community, because we could not get support for the French school in our community. How does the federal government propose to support young immigrant children who are coming and would like to take up French in provinces outside of Quebec?

Madam Speaker, I have heard a couple of times tonight in the debate the mention of the 4.4% target for immigration, but I have also heard a couple of times tonight about the importance of children who are immigrating here to learn French, and actually the demand for it. When parents come, they want their children, outside of Quebec and all across Canada, to be able to learn French. Does the member have any ideas about how the federal government could support immigrant children coming to Canada to learn French in provinces outside of Quebec?
